Heritage has enjoyed the comforts of home their last two games, but now they'll head out on the road. They will challenge the JW North Huskies at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day. JW North took a loss in their last matchup and will be looking to turn the tables on Heritage, who comes in off a win.
Heritage put the finishing touches on their tenth blowout victory of the season on Friday. Everything went their way against Temescal Canyon as Heritage made off with a 77-52 victory. For those keeping track at home, that's the biggest victory Heritage has posted since December 27, 2023.
Sierra Maxwell continued her habit of posting crazy stat lines, going 6 for 12 from beyond the arc en route to 56 points and 2 assists. As a matter of fact, that's the most points she has scored all season. The team also got some help courtesy of Mariah Logan, who scored seven points along with three steals.
Meanwhile, JW North's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Friday after their ninth straight loss. They fell just short of Rancho Verde by a score of 50-48.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est loss JW North has suffered yet this season.
Heritage's win was their eighth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 15-9. Those victories were due in large part to their offensive dominance across that stretch, as they averaged 70.4 points per game. As for JW North, they have been struggling recently, as they've lost 11 of their last 13 cont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 3-16 record this season.
Everything came up roses for Heritage against JW North in their previous meeting on January 5th as the team secured a 80-32 victory. The rematch might be a little tougher for Heritage since the squad won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
